Kensico Cemetery and the vaudevillians' section
1889
Valhalla, New York
Anthony22 at English Wikipedia · CC BY-SA 3.0 · Wikimedia Commons
Kensico was founded in 1889 when Manhattan's graveyards were filling up and the railroads made rural burial practical. Sergei Rachmaninoff is buried here, along with a great many other performers of the early twentieth century. The cemetery set aside a section for members of the Actors' Fund of America and the National Vaudeville Association, a good number of whom had died broke, which is the part of show business that does not usually get a monument.
